KanBan

Kanban is a concept related to lean and just-in-time (JIT) production. Kanban is a signaling system to trigger action. As its name suggests, kanban historically uses cards to signal the need for an item.

Hurst Green Plastics Ltd have embraced this theory to offer a true Kanban system for your storage and dispensing. When the bins are empty, the user simply pulls the slider to drop down a reserve stock. The upper bin can be clearly identified for replenishment and re-ordered. Importantly, there are no stock-outs and manufacturing can continue.

With the new FlagBin™ dispenser, this identification of stock levels is very clear. You can see exactly what level the bins are in without having to check.

Green = reserve chamber of TwinBin full of product

Red = Reserve chamber has been emptied

Red/Yellow = Reserve chamber has been re-ordered

Green = Reserve chamber has been refilled and the process can continue
